One thing I like about this new software is that the layout is very customizable by the user. There are 3 styles to choose from as before in your user control panel>board preferences, but also you can put the user profiles on thread pages on the left or right. Also if you click on the square icon over the menu bar on the top right, it takes you to the portal page where you can drag the portal blocks anywhere you like. Any ones you put on the sides will appear on the sides on the forum index as well, and any blocks you put in the center will not show on the forum index.

If you like everything about this style except the narrowness, use prosilver. This is prosilver special edition I have for the default style. It is just a narrow version of prosilver with less blue highlights. I have added the dropdown menus and header images and removed the site name and description from the header on both styles.

subsilver2 is more for people with slower machines and connections. It looks pretty much exactly like subSilver on the old software. I have not applied any syle edits to this template other than ones that need to be there to make modifications and add-ons work. It is lite on the images and style related scripts.
